David Chase
David Chase (born August 22, 1945 in Mount Vernon, New York) is an American television writer, director and producer . He is best known for creating the successful HBO series The Sopranos, about a modern Mafia family living in New Jersey, which debuted in 1999 to almost instant acclaim.

Prior to creating and developing The Sopranos, Chase produced episodes of Northern Exposure and The Rockford Files, among other series. He also worked as a lead writer on The Rockford Files.

An Italian American who grew up in a Baptist family in New Jersey, Chase was born David DeCesare. His daughter Michele DeCesare plays the character Hunter Scangarelo on The Sopranos.

Chase was friends with John Patterson, who directed every season finale of The Sopranos. Patterson died on February 7, 2005.
